tar·tan 1

T0052000 (tär′tn)n.1. a. Any of numerous textile patterns consisting of stripes of varying widths and colors crossed at right angles against a solid background, each forming a distinctive design worn by the members of a Scottish clan.b. A twilled wool fabric or garment having such a pattern.2. A plaid fabric.
[Middle English tartane, possibly from Old French tiretaine, linsey-woolsey, probably from tiret, a kind of cloth, from tire, silk cloth, from Latin Tyrius, Tyrian (cloth), from Tyrus, Tyre.]
tar′tan adj.

tar·tan 2

T0052000 (tär′tn, tär-tăn′)n. A small, single-masted Mediterranean ship with a large lateen sail.
[French tartane, from Provençal tartano, from Old Provençal tartana, buzzard, of imitative origin.]

see plaidplaid,
a long shawl or blanketlike outer wrap of woolen cloth, usually patterned in checks or tartan figures. Now a distinctive feature of the Highland costume, it was formerly worn in all parts of Scotland and in N England by both men and women.

TARTAN

A simple language proposed to meet the Ironman requirements.

["TARTAN - Language Design for the Ironman Requirements:Reference Manual", Mary Shaw et al, SIGPLAN Notices13(9):36-58 (Sep 1978)].
